not only a very poor choice of platform, but calling this a ā€œmetaverse weddingā€ is like calling GDQ ā€œmetaverse speedrunningā€ because there’s an (unofficial) world in VRChat which was dedicated to the stream

more and more in-person conventions are having a VR portal to their virtual convention, where the people on both sides actually want to interact with each other to the extent the magfest badges had a multiplayer game on them with skeletal data live from VRChat
while here, it sounds like they were more annoyed about it than anything else

and you compare this to furality last week, people performing in VR to crowds of thousands, broadcast as holograms within 50+ individual instances

can the biggest companies in the world not find someone that a. actually cares about what they’re doing, and b. is still willing to work with them?
